    Window-Repairs.-150x150.jpgReplacement Handles For UPVC Windows

    uPVC handles can become loose or fall off. With the proper tools, it's not difficult to replace the handles.

    Find the screws or pins holding the handle in place to identify the kind of handle. Once you've found them, remove the pins or screws, and carefully pull the handle off of its spindle.

    Espag Handle

    Espag handles are most commonly found on double-glazed uPVC Windows. They are round and flat in shape. They are typically made from uPVC, but they can also be made of different materials, based on the window's design and style. Handles come in a variety of shapes and colors to match the decor of your home.

    The espag handle for patio door can also be known as a spade handle or the cockspur handle. It can be used to replace a damaged handle on an older uPVC window. They're not as secure as modern handle styles however they do have an easy locking mechanism. The handle is made of two round studs called mushrooms that are able to move upwards and downwards as the handle is rotated. These catch into a metal plate on the frame called a keep. The handle can also be found in a cranked design which provides more space for your hand with a more sleek appearance. Or an inline version.

    These types of uPVC window handles are often found on older wooden windows, as well as double-glazed windows. They are typically made of aluminium or uPVC however they can also be made from other materials. Espag window handles are locked using a key or with wedge blocks that fit between the frame and handle. They are also easy to maintain and you can get replacement parts in the event of a fail to function.

    To choose the best espag handle for your window, first determine the size of the spindle that is on the back of the handle. This should be a minimum of 7mm in diameter. Also, you should measure the height of the step where the handle will fit on the window frame. The proper size handle will ensure that the window is closed with a tight seal.

    Monkey tail espag handles are a great option for windows with a history. They also work well with modern window styles and come in right- or left-handed versions. They feature a chic design with a reeded finish at the end and a slim backplate that can be inserted into the frame of the window. These handles are also lockable and come with a decent step in height.

    Pear Drop Handle

    If your upvc door handles window handle or lock is damaged, you'll likely want to replace it with a new model. It's a fairly simple process and can be done yourself. First, make sure that your window is shut and take out the screw that is at the base of the handle. This will reveal two additional screws. Once they are removed, the handle will disappear. The multipoint lock can be removed by removing the two screws. Once the new handle has been made, screw it into place. If your handle is equipped with an encapsulated screw, put this back on, too.

    Espagnolette handles are the most popular kind of handle for uPVC windows. They are easily identifiable by their flat strip shape and are compatible with multipoint locks that are placed on the frame to provide industry-leading home security. They are available in various designs and are available with either a left or right opening.

    Cockspur handles are a more traditional design of handle. They are popular for their heritage enhancements, and for those who prefer an appearance that is more traditional. These handles come with a spindle that goes through the handle before entering the gearbox. This turns a series shootbolt rod to secure the window handle repair.

    Pear drop handles are a more contemporary option than cockspur handle styles and offer the same level of security. They're a great option for those who want to modernize their windows by installing a modern handle that's still a good to match the historical background of their property.

    Handle that tilts and turns

    Tilt and turn handles are used on double-glazed windows that swing inwards and can be tilted back or down for ventilation. The handle is rotated and a lock mechanism is activated when the window is tipped into either position. These windows are extremely popular in Europe. They provide better airflow, and are more secure. When replacing the handle of a uPVC tilt and turn handle, the new handle must be compatible with the window style and locking mechanism to ensure security and functionality.

    Tilt-and turn windows are typically constructed from uPVC or aluminum frames. Timber frames are used by homeowners who prefer a more traditional feel and style to their home. UPVC frames are the most affordable option and offer great durability energy efficiency, as well as minimal maintenance requirements. Aluminum frames are more expensive, but offer superior durability and resistance to corrosion.

    The uPVC handle turns and tilts in a similar manner to an espagnolette, but is much heavier and bulkier because it is used on larger windows. They are also more durable because they are able to be able to withstand more forces when the window opens to the inside and is able to be turned.

    The most important thing to consider when replacing a tilt-and-turn handle is that it can be locked into one of four positions. This will prevent the window from being opened all the way into the room. It is possible to accomplish this with a lock key. This is especially useful when there are children around, as it keeps them from opening the windows too much.

    When buying a tilt and turn window handle it is crucial to measure the handle you have to determine the best design to match. You'll need to determine the distance between the screw fixing holes, which are normally 43mm centre to centre. You may need to take off the caps that cover the covers or the backplates with sprung load from some handles to reveal the screw positions.
